One of the most important assets of a business is its people. Hiring the right people who are a good fit for your business culture can be challenging. But once you’ve cleared that hurdle, it’s time to invest in you and your team so that you can avoid the costly ramifications of high turnover: re-hiring, re-training and onboarding, development and the ground lost when you have a job vacancy for an extended period of time. This is where securing one of the best online learning platforms for growing skillets and training comes into play.

According to OnStaff USA, training directly impacts employee satisfaction and engagement, both critical to an organization’s retention and success. Gallup data shows that the employee engagement which hit new highs during the pandemic has dropped back to just slightly higher than the pre-pandemic rate of 35%, to 36%.

What is an Online Learning Platform?

An online learning platform gives businesses a leg up with continuing education for you and your employees, elevating the knowledge across a wide range of subject matter. More importantly, skill-building can lead to more engaged employees, eager to put new knowledge to work. Online learning may be live instruction or recorded content that can be viewed whenever it’s convenient for a team or individual learner through a portal. 2. Pluralsight

It’s in the Details: Best for Data Learning

Drawing the smarts of industry experts, Pluralsight offers thousands of courses designed to “upskill” your technology knowledge at beginner, intermediate and advanced levels in software development, machine learning and AI, information and cybersecurity, and more. Labs and interactive courses provide hands-on opportunities to learn by doing. You’ll also find course content aligned with industry certifications.

Pluralsight

Individual Plans

  • Standard — $29/month for access to the core course library, paths and skills assessments.
  • Premium — $45/month for access to the full library of core and expanded courses, exams, projects and hands-on learning.

Team Plans

  • Starter — $399 per user/annually, features access to the core library.
  • Professional — $579 per user/annually, includes basic reporting and user analytics for teams.
  • Enterprise — $799 per user/ annually, includes flexibility and advanced analytics.

5. Coursera

Reaching New Goals: Best for College-level Classes

If you’re looking for unlimited access to more than 100 subject areas to empower your team to master new skills, look into Coursera for Teams. This online learning platform suits businesses with 5 to 125 learners.  A 2019 users’ survey shows that 87% of those learning for professional development report career benefits like promotions, raises, and starting a new career.

Coursera

Platform highlights include:

  • Over 4,000 courses from top universities
  • Guided projects, assessments, and quizzes
  • Verified certificates upon course completion

Team Pricing: $399 per user/year – For teams and smaller organizations with unlimited access to the entire course catalog.

9. Codecademy

Technical Learning: Best for Developers and Learning Code

Complex challenges for technical skills are brought down to a manageable size to help you tackle your obstacles to doing better business with Codecademy‘s online learning platform. Beginner courses teach data analysis, full-stack engineering, Java, HTML, and more. Intermediate courses build on the fundamentals to elevate skills even further.

Codecademy
  • Free basic account that gives you access to interactive lessons, limited practice and peer support.
  • Pro account is $19.99/month and opens up members-only content, real-world projects, step-by-step guidance and certificates of complete.
  • Teams gives you everything accessible via a Pro account plus team performance reports, unlimited license switching and flexible start dates. You will need to get a quote for 50 or more users.

Online Learning Platforms FAQs

How Much Do Online Learning Platforms Cost?

An online learning platform is an investment in yourself and in your business that can pay dividends across your business with more engaged and loyal employees with valuable skill sets. There is a wide range of pricing, based on the number of learners you have and the length of time you want to provide learning opportunities.

What Kind of Features Do Online Learning Platforms Have?

Typical features at a business or team level include a dedicated dashboard for monitoring progress, customizable learning tracks, collaboration with a content manager who can help you define curriculum, and some certification-level courses. All open access to industry professionals or academic leaders to ensure you are learning from a range of subject matter experts.

How Do You Choose the Best Online Learning Platforms?

The best place to start is to evaluate your specific needs: Are you looking to enhance your skillset as a business owner, reward individuals, or advance the skills of your entire team? Is it one specific group, like mid-level managers, that can benefit from skill-building, or do you see opportunity across departments? Do you have beginners that need to level up or more seasoned pros who need exposure to new technologies in a rapidly changing field like IT?
